kart. Condition: Gut. 28 S. : Ill., graph. Darst. ; 24 cm; Sehr gutes Ex. - Englisch. - In recent years a new branch of nanoscience/nanotechnology seems to emerge. This branch is characterized by the application of preparation methods and/or diagnostic tools developed in nanoscience/nanotechnology to areas that were originally not related to nanoscience/nanotechnology, such as e.g. cancer research or quantum physics. These applications open the way to perform either new, decisive experiments or they permit novel technological applications. In order to highlight the remarkable diversity of this new development, the following four areas will be discussed. (1) Labelling of biological structures by quantum dots, (n) cancer therapy by nanometer-sized particles, (in) synthesis of solid materials with tuneable atomic structures in the form of nanoglasses and (iv) new opportunities provided by nanoscience/nanotechnology to probe the limits of quantum physics, one of the classical problems of physics. . Druck auf Anfrage Neuware - Printed after ordering - In an attempt to meet the demand for new ultra-high strength materials, the processing of novel material configurations with unique microstructure is being explored in systems which are further and further from equilibrium. One such class of emerging materials is the so-called nanophased or nanostructured materials. This class of materials includes metals and alloys, ceramics, and polymers characterized by controlled ultra-fine microstructural features in the form oflayered, fibrous, or phase and grain distribution. While it is clear that these materials are in an early stage of development, there is now a sufficient body of literature to fuel discussion of how the mechanical properties and deformation behavior can be controlled through control of the microstructure. This NATO-Advanced Study Institute was convened in order to assess our current state of knowledge in the field of mechanical properties and deformation behavior in materials with ultra fine microstructure, to identify opportunities and needs for further research, and to identify the potential for technological applications. The Institute was the first international scientific meeting devoted to a discussion on the mechanical properties and deformation behavior of materials having grain sizes down to a few nanometers. Included in these discussions were the topics of superplasticity, tribology, and the supermodulus effect. Lectures were also presented which covered a variety of other themes including synthesis, characterization, thermodynamic stability, and general physical properties.

The NATO ASI which produced this book was the first international scientific meeting devoted to a discussion of the mechanical properties and deformation behavior of materials having grain sizes down to a few nanometers. Topics covered include superplasticity, tribology, and the supermodulus effect. Review chapters cover a variety of other themes including synthesis, characterization, thermodynamic stability, and general physical properties. Much of the work is concerned with the issue of how far conventional techniques and concepts can be extended toward atomic scale probing. Another key issue concerns the structure of nanocrystalline materials, in particular, what is the structure and composition of the internal boundaries. These ultra-fine microstructures have proved to challenge even the finest probes that the materials science community has today.
